WebAdditionally, most of the so-called grain-free use vegetables such as tapioca, lentils, sweet potatoes, pumpkin, pea (good fiber source), among others. However, before giving any vegetables to your feline pal, ensure they are safe. Some such as avocado, mushrooms, rhubarb, onions, leeks, garlic, or other genus members Allium are toxic to cats. WebMay 16, 2024 · Some vegetables that may be safe for the cats to eat include cucumber, steamed broccoli, carrots and asparagus, and peas. Unlike humans, cats are not omnivores; cats are carnivores.
